Natural Substances That Can Help Improve Focus and Concentration


Maintaining focus and concentration can be challenging in today's fast-paced world. With constant distractions and information overload, many individuals struggle to stay attentive to tasks and goals. While various strategies and techniques enhance focus, one avenue that is gaining attention is using natural substances. These substances, often derived from plants and herbs, are believed to have properties that can support cognitive function and improve concentration. This article will delve into some natural substances that have shown promise in enhancing focus and concentration.

1. Caffeine: The Classic Focus Enhancer

Caffeine, found in coffee, tea, and specific energy drinks, is one of the most well-known natural substances for boosting focus and alertness. It works by blocking adenosine receptors in the brain, which helps to increase the release of dopamine and norepinephrine, neurotransmitters that play a crucial role in attention and wakefulness. Moderate caffeine consumption has linked to improved cognitive function, enhanced mood, and increased attention span. However, excessive consumption can lead to jitteriness, anxiety, and disrupted sleep patterns. webtechradar

2. Ginkgo Biloba: Ancient Herb for Modern Focus

Ginkgo biloba is an herbal supplement used for centuries in traditional medicine to enhance memory and cognitive function. It is thought to improve blood circulation and increase oxygen supply to the brain. Some studies suggest that ginkgo biloba may help improve attention and concentration, particularly in individuals with age-related cognitive decline. While more research is needed to understand its mechanisms and effectiveness fully, ginkgo biloba remains a popular natural option for supporting brain health.  beautyscafe

3. Bacopa Monnieri: Ayurvedic Brain Booster

Bacopa monnieri, an herb commonly used in Ayurvedic medicine, has gained attention for its potential to enhance cognitive function and reduce anxiety. It believes to work by promoting the growth of nerve endings, improving synaptic communication, and reducing oxidative stress in the brain. Several studies have shown that Bacopa monnieri supplementation can improve memory, attention, and information processing. Its adaptogenic properties also make it a promising natural substance for managing stress, which can positively impact focus. workebook

4. Rhodiola Rosea: Adaptogen for Stress and Focus

Rhodiola rosea is an adaptogenic herb used in traditional medicine to combat stress and fatigue. It is thought to regulate the body's stress response by influencing the release of stress hormones. By reducing stress and promoting a sense of well-being, Rhodiola rosea indirectly supports improved focus and concentration. Some studies suggest it may enhance cognitive performance, mainly when mental fatigue is a factor. theslashgear

5. L-Theanine: Calm Focus from Tea Leaves

L-theanine is an amino acid found in tea leaves, mainly green tea. It is known for its ability to promote relaxation and reduce stress without causing drowsiness. When combined with caffeine, as naturally occurs in tea, L-theanine can have a synergistic effect. It helps to smooth out the jittery side effects of caffeine, providing a focused yet calm state of mind. This combination has improved attention, accuracy, and cognitive performance in tasks requiring sustained focus.

6. Omega-3 Fatty Acids: Brain-Boosting Healthy Fats

Omega-3 fatty acids, found abundantly in fatty fish like salmon and certain nuts and seeds, are essential for brain health and function. These fatty acids play a crucial role in maintaining the integrity of cell membranes in the brain and promoting communication between nerve cells. Research suggests a diet rich in omega-3s may improve cognitive function, attention, and memory. Omega-3 supplements are also available for individuals who may not consume enough through their diet.

7. Panax Ginseng: Traditional Root for Mental Clarity

Panax ginseng, often Asian ginseng, has been used in traditional medicine to enhance energy, vitality, and mental clarity. It is believed to promote healthy blood flow and reduce oxidative stress in the brain. Some studies suggest that Panax ginseng may positively impact cognitive function, attention, and memory. However, its effects can vary depending on dosage and individual response.

8. Meditation and Mindfulness: Training the Mind for Focus

While not a substance in the traditional sense, meditation and mindfulness practices are worth mentioning in the context of improving focus. These practices involve training the mind to stay present and attentive, which can lead to enhanced concentration over time. Research has shown that regular meditation and mindfulness practice can lead to structural changes in the brain that support improved attention, emotional regulation, and cognitive function.

Conclusion

Incorporating natural substances into your routine to improve focus and concentration can be a holistic approach to cognitive enhancement. However, it's important to note that individual responses to these substances can vary, and their effects may not be as potent as those of prescription medications. Before adding any new supplements to your regimen, it's advisable to consult with a healthcare professional, especially if you have underlying medical conditions or are taking other medications. Focusing on a healthy lifestyle that includes a balanced diet, regular exercise, quality sleep, and stress management can further contribute to optimal cognitive function and attention.
